Mexican Seasoning

Introduction:
Mexican Seasoning captures the bold, rustic, and vibrant flavors of Mexican cuisine. Usually containing chili powder, cumin, garlic, oregano, and paprika, this blend brings smoky heat and earthy richness to dishes. Rooted in traditional Mexican cooking but widely adapted in Tex-Mex cuisine, it is essential for tacos, fajitas, nachos, and chili con carne.
